Portal hypertension, a condition characterized by abnormally high blood pressure in the portal vein, is a serious threat to health. The buildup of pressure can lead to enlarged veins in the esophagus and stomach, creating a risk of life-threatening bleeding.

Traditionally, the treatment for this condition has been limited to medications and procedures that aimed to control bleeding but did not address the underlying cause. Now, a groundbreaking new treatment approach offers a glimmer of hope to patients living with this debilitating condition.

Recent advancements in medical science have led to the development of a novel therapy that directly targets the enlarged veins responsible for bleeding in portal hypertension. This innovative method involves using a special sealant to block the offending veins, effectively eliminating the threat of hemorrhage.
